Onboarding note for the Ledgerpane admin table: bulk edits are applied through the batcher service, not directly against the database. Select rows, choose an action, and the batcher stages changes in a pending set you can review before commit. Edits over 500 rows require a second approver — this is enforced server-side, so don't try to chunk around it. To run the batcher locally you need the staging write credential, which goes in your .env as the next line.

secret setting of bahip-kagag: RELAY_SECRET3=c83

**Mgmt Meeting Minutes — Retiring the Brightline Range**

Quick recap for sales leads at Fenholt Supplies: we agreed to retire the Brightline fixture range by year-end. Remaining stock moves to clearance pricing next month, and accounts on standing orders get migrated to the Lumetta range. Trade-in incentives were approved in principle. The confidential note on next steps sits just below.

board note of bajof-bajeg: The pricing group signed off on a budget of $13.4 million for Project Sildor. The renewal with Lamixek Holdings closes at $48.9 million a year, 49 percent above the last contract.

Runbook §3 — Pinpointly autocomplete widget

Okay, so shipping the Pinpointly address autocomplete widget is mostly painless. Bump the version in widget-config, run the smoke suite against the Larchford sandbox, and make sure the suggestion latency stays under 120ms. If the typeahead starts returning empty results, it's almost always the index job — just rerun it, don't restart the cluster. Once smoke is green, sign the bundle before pushing to the CDN with the following key:

release key, yagap-kagag: bky6_1ks93y

Ticket: Staging env misconfigured for Siftgate bloom filter

The bloom layer in front of the Pellet KV store is rejecting all lookups in staging because the env file was copied from the dev template without credentials. False-positive tuning values are fine; only the auth line is missing. To unblock the weekly demo, the Pellet admission secret must be set on the following line.

env line for yaguf-fajop: LEDGER_TOKEN13=fb08984397349